资源简介

此工具应用于Android端与硬件通过socket通信时,需要传递的字节流,用于16进制数据流和字符串的相互转换工具类

资源截图

代码片段和文件信息

package com.crlgc.basestation.utils;

import java.text.SimpleDateFormat;
import java.util.ArrayList;
import java.util.Date;
import java.util.List;

/**
 * 字节操作
 * Created by admin on 2016-12-14.
 */
public class ByteUtil {

    /**
     * 字节数组转16进制字符串
     * 

TODO:
     *
     * @param bytes 字节数组
     * @return 转换后的以16进制显示的字符串
     * @author Evan
     * @date 2015-4-8 下午8:34:40
     */
    public static String toHexString(byte[] bytes) {
        String returnStr = ““;
        if (bytes != null) {
            for (int i = 0; i < bytes.length; i++) {
                returnStr += Integer.toString((bytes[i] & 0xff) + 0x100 16).substring(1);
            }
        }
        return returnStr;
    }

    /**
     * 16进制字符串转byte数组
     * 

TODO:
     *
     *


评论

共有 条评论